In the early 1940s, a German pastor and anti-Nazi dissident named Dietrich Bonhoeffer was captured by the Gestapo and imprisoned for two years before being hung by the Nazi regime. During his imprisonment, Bonhoeffer reflected on the nature of evil and came to one resolute conclusion: stupidity is far worse.

The pastor argued that stupidity (not ignorance, not evil) is the more destructive force shaping societies. Indeed, while some may believe that cruelty, malice, or deliberate evil bears more negative weight, stupidity might very well be the thing that helps these forces along.
